Digests are assembled by the Coalheap worker every hour, but actual sends respect each tenant's configured window and time zone. If a window is missed (worker outage, queue backlog), the scheduler rolls the batch forward rather than double-sending. Manual replays are possible from the ops console, but replaying more than 24 hours of digests requires unlocking the scheduler's protected mode. That unlock prompt accepts the operations recovery passphrase, which is maintained directly below this entry.

unlock words, hahip-baduf: holwyn-istath-julvan

Welcome aboard! The inventory reconciliation job (we call it "Stockmatch") runs nightly at Larkvale and compares warehouse counts against the Ordenza ledger. It's mostly boring, but when it drifts more than 2%, it halts and locks its state vault to prevent bad writes. Future maintainers: don't re-run it blindly. To unlock the vault after a halt, use the recovery passphrase below.

vault phrase of kafog-kahif = holdor-rusir-praox

// REPORT_EXPORT_TZ: fallback zone for Quartzline report exports.
// On-call: if exports look shifted by a few hours, someone's org
// probably lacks a zone setting and fell back here. Don't change
// this to UTC at 2am; finance reports depend on it. The exporter
// logs which build applied the fallback, right below.

session token of tajef-bageg = htk21_5d90d574934f3ccae6437

**Handover — query planner regression (Torvald ➜ Ines)**

Hi Ines, quick brain dump before I'm off. The planner in Brookfell 3.2 started picking sequential scans on the orders table after the stats refresh — rollback patch is staged but not merged. If the staging vault times you out while testing, use the emergency recovery flow. The passphrase for that is below.

vault phrase of bagaf-kajeg = jorath-feniel-briir-siliel-ralix

## Formula sandbox tuning

User-supplied formulas in Gridmoor execute inside a restricted interpreter with hard ceilings on time, memory, and call depth. Reviewers should confirm any change to these ceilings is justified in the PR description, since raising them widens the abuse surface. Defaults were chosen from production traces. The current limits are as follows.

limits module of tafog-fawip:
WEIGHTS = {
    "julix": 57,
    "lamys": 992,
    "kasvan": 209,
    "quenok": 750,
    "alddor": 259,
    "oliath": 1009,
    "wenix": 815,
}